About SHERIF Z. YACOUB

Meet Dr. Sherif Z. Yacoub, a reputable endocrinologist in Charleston, SC. Dr. Sherif obtained his medical degree from Ain Shams University Hospital in Cairo, Egypt, followed by his residency at New York Medical College, Metropolitan Hospital Center. Subsequently, he completed an endocrinology fellowship at the Medical University of South Carolina (MUSC). Dr. Yacoub is double-board certified in endocrinology and internal medicine. Patients can consult with him at Roper St. Francis Physician Partners Endocrinology in Mount Pleasant, affiliated with Bon Secours St. Francis Hospital, Roper Hospital, Roper Mount Pleasant Hospital, and Roper St. Francis Berkeley Hospital.
